Often spotted in large flocks, the fieldfare is an attractive thrush. It is a winter visitor, enjoying the feast of seasonal berries the UK's hedgerows, woodlands and parks have to offer.

The herring gull is the typical 'seagull' of our seaside resorts, though our coastal populations have declined in recent decades.
